The Power of Physical Fitness for Overall Well-being

Physical fitness is not just about having a toned body; it's a crucial component of overall well-being. Incorporating regular physical activity into your routine can have a profound impact on your mental, emotional, and physical health.
Benefits of Physical Fitness:
- Improved cardiovascular health
- Enhanced muscular strength and flexibility
- Weight management and increased metabolism
- Boosted immune system
- Stress relief and improved mood
- Better sleep quality
Embracing an Active Lifestyle:
Engaging in activities like brisk walking, running, swimming, or yoga can elevate your fitness levels and contribute to your overall well-being. It's essential to find activities that you enjoy and can sustain in the long term.
Finding Balance:
While physical fitness is vital, it's equally important to listen to your body and give it adequate rest. Overtraining can lead to injuries and burnout. Balance your workouts with rest days and proper nutrition to support your fitness journey.
